CrowdStrike Holdings Inc. today unveiled a new incident response service for Amazon Web Services Inc. customers that offers cyber protection from the CrowdStrike Falcon cybersecurity platform at preferred rates in the AWS Marketplace.
Announced at the AWS re:Inforce 2025 conference, the new Falcon for AWS Security Incident Response offers AI-powered incident response and is designed to help organizations respond to incidents faster, reduce risk and strengthen their cloud security posture. It does so while providing joint customers significant cost savings and an integrated security workflow, all managed within existing AWS environments, according to the companies.
The new offering seeks to assist with the growing speed and complexity of cyberattacks that CrowdStrike says now outpace traditional response efforts, particularly in cloud environments. The Falcon platform detects 96% more threats in half the time and investigates incidents 66% faster than other offerings, significantly improving the ability to stop breaches.
The Falcon platform doesn’t replace the existing AWS Security Incident Response’s automated triage and investigation workflow, but instead complements it to create a solution that spans the entire security incident lifecycle. The bundled offering gives joint customers streamlined procurement while adding to their overall security posture through AWS infrastructure.
